Bank Run Exposure in a Paycheck-to-Paycheck Economy with Loss-Averse Depositors
G. Charles-Cadogan
Abstract
We develop a behavioural model of bank run exposure in a paycheck-to-paycheck economy with loss averse depositors. Income is received through demand deposits, and consumption ratcheting embeds reference dependence in a parsimonious asset-pricing framework. We show that sufficiently high subjective bad-state probabilities endogenously increase liquidity demand and generate equilibrium stress states supporting bank runs. These states define a Bank Run Exposure State Space and yield a martingale representation for exposure dynamics. A proof-of-concept empirical implementation using Call Report data constructs bank-level exposure proxies from funding and lending composition. A regression-weighted composite measure modestly improves fit relative to a retail-share benchmark, with stronger amplification among small banks and during the post-Silicon Valley Bank (SVB) collapse period. The framework highlights how behavioural liquidity demand alters equilibrium reserve holdings and can crowd out productive lending.
